    GTA VI Trailer 2 Lives, and it is Epic

    The second GTA VI trailer reveals a breathtaking visual experience that transcends gaming. The new RAGE engine of Rockstar offers near-photorealism graphics, presenting an engaging world that obliterates the difference between game and life. From the sparkling seas of Vice City beaches to the minute details of its urban landscape, each frame is full of awe-inspiring visuals. A global illumination system provides realism by having light dynamically interact with environments to create realistic shadows, dynamic sunsets, and energetic neon-lit streets. The trailer presents record-level detail, from the stretch marks on the character’s skin to the realistic texture of water, the carefully crafted interiors, and a general feeling of immersion. The wide-open world of Leonida, Florida-inspired, is enormous and vibrant with varied environments that range from cosmopolitan cities to vast swamplands. The fans have welcomed the graphical enhancements from Red Dead Redemption 2, already a gold standard for graphics.

    Samsung Galaxy Watch 8 May Launch with Antioxidant Index Monitoring

    Samsung is about to shake the wearable world yet again, and this time wellness like never before appears to be the focus. The next Galaxy Watch 8, which has been rumored to hit the shelves in the latter half of 2025, might bring an extremely special health-centric feature along with the Antioxidant Index. Designed to give wearers a deeper look into their body’s wellness levels, this tool might help track beta carotene levels with a marker tied to your antioxidant status, right from your wrist.

    Apple iPhone Air Won’t Be a One-Off, Future Models Already in the Pipeline: Report

    Apple is preparing to release the super-thin iPhone 17 Air later this year, which will allegedly take the place of the existing Plus model in the iPhone series. As per a report, this new iPhone Air model won’t be a one-off. Apple has already begun making plans for future generations of the Air variant, suggesting it will become a part of the brand’s yearly iPhone update cycle. A big update is also imminent in 2027, according to the report.

    YouTube Tests Shared Premium Plan for Two Users at Rs 219 Per Month: Report

    YouTube is trying out a new two-user subscription option that enables two users to share YouTube Premium or Music Premium membership. The Google-owned video streaming service is testing the two-user Premium option in some markets, such as India, France, Taiwan, and Hong Kong, in a small number of users.

    The new YouTube Premium two-member subscription is priced at Rs 219 per month in India. For comparison, the existing YouTube Premium Family Plan, which supports up to five users, is currently available at Rs 299 per month.

    For YouTube Music Premium, the two-user plan is reportedly priced at Rs 149 per month.

    Microsoft Closes Down Skype on May 5, Requests Users to Switch to Teams

    Microsoft formally shut down Skype on 5 May 2025, bringing an end to the era of one of the most popular video call services. The US tech firm had in February 2025 made public its plan to phase out Skype in a bid to strengthen its communication platforms. In future, Microsoft will concentrate its communication and collaboration offering on Microsoft Teams (Free).

    On February 28, Microsoft announced in a blog post that it would eliminate Skype to make the company adapt more easily to changing consumer patterns. When the transition started, Microsoft discontinued the sale of Skype Credit and calling feature plans for new customers. Nonetheless, current subscribers can still keep using their plans until the end of their bill cycle. What’s more, any leftover Skype credit will still be usable. The Skype Dial Pad will continue to be accessible for paid users through the Skype web portal and in Microsoft Teams, after May 5, 2025.
